Chennai, April 3, Virat Kohli arrived at his adopted second home M Chinnaswamy Stadium after 1427 days in IPL and the talismanic India cricketer didn't disappoint the passionate Royal Challengers Bangalore fans who turned up in large numbers to watch their team in action from the ground.
Kohli's masterful knock along with captain Faf du Plessis and their third century stand in IPL ensured RCB didn't have to break much sweat and claimed an emphatic 8-wicket win over Mumbai Indians.
The star-studded commentary panel on Star Sports lavished praise upon King Kohli for his superb knock against a high-quality Mumbai Indians bowling line-up.
